Tu Youyou is a Chinese pharmaceutical chemist (药学家). She was born in 1930 in Zhejiang. In 1969, she started to research a way to treat malaria (疟疾), a disease that killed millions of people every year.
Tu and her team tried over 2,000 traditional Chinese medicines. They worked day and night in small labs without modern equipment. Finally, in 1971, they found artemisinin (青蒿素), a medicine that could cure malaria. This discovery saved millions of lives around the world.
In 2015, Tu Youyou won the Nobel Prize in Medicine. She was the first Chinese woman to win this prize. She said, “I did what I could to help people. It’s our duty to make the world a better place.”

Lang Ping is a famous volleyball player and coach. She was born in 1960 in Tianjin. When she was young, she loved playing volleyball. She joined the Chinese national volleyball team in 1981.
Under her leadership, the Chinese team won many international games, including the World Championship and the Olympic Games. Lang Ping is called “Iron Hammer” because she is strong and never gives up.
After retiring as a player, she became a coach. She coached the Chinese women’s volleyball team to win the Olympic gold medal in 2016. She said, “Volleyball is not just a sport. It’s about teamwork and never giving up.”
